Responsibilities

  • Implement ABA therapy plans under the supervision of a Board Certified Behavior

    Analyst (BCBA)

  • Provide one-on-one ABA therapy to individuals with developmental disabilities

  • Collect and record data on individual's progress and behaviors through Central

    Reach

  • Collaborate with the BCBA and other team members to develop and implement

    behavior intervention plans

  • Maintain a safe and supportive environment for individuals receiving ABA therapy
